What are the benefits of a projector?
When compared to televisions, projectors enjoy the inherent advantage of larger screen sizes….Eye Comfort Bottom Line:
- Projectors reflect light; TVs emit light.
- Reflected light is less straining, more comfortable.
- Projectors produce bigger images.
- Larger images create easier viewing, less strain.
Can a projector light damage your eyes?
Do projectors emit blue light? Unfortunately, the answer is yes. Prolonged exposure to blue light will also lead to eyestrain, fatigue, pain, and dry eye. Cumulatively these issues can cause damage to the retina cell, which causes degradation in vision.

How big should a projector screen be?
Projectors screen size can readily create images larger than what is possible for TVs; a screen of over 100 inches or even 200 inches can be produced easily. For those looking for eye comfort, projectors’ large screens are even better. Larger screens create images that are bigger and more comfortable for the eyes to view.
